Understanding Traffic Patterns and Timing
One of the most critical aspects of succeeding in these types of games is mastering the art of reading traffic. Itās not enough to simply react to vehicles as they approach; a skilled player anticipates their movements. This involves observing the speed, spacing, and trajectories of cars, trucks, and other vehicles that populate the road. Initially, traffic patterns might appear random, but with repeated play, players begin to discern subtle cues and identify gaps in the flow. Recognizing that larger vehicles generally have slower acceleration, and that vehicles further down the road pose a less immediate threat, are crucial observations. Learning to exploit these patterns forms the foundation for consistent success.
Developing Predictive Skills
Predictive skill isnāt innate; itās cultivated through practice and focused attention. Pay close attention to the speed at which vehicles are moving. A car appearing to approach slowly might still present a hazard if itās accelerating. Similarly, a gap that looks initially safe could quickly close if another vehicle enters it. Players should also consider the visual cues provided by the game itself ā such as the distance between vehicles and the speed at which they are traveling across the screen. Furthermore, understanding how traffic lanes interact with each other is vital; a vehicle changing lanes unexpectedly can disrupt your planned path. Itās about shifting from reactive gameplay to proactive anticipation.
| Traffic Type | Typical Speed | Hazard Level | Mitigation Strategy |
|---|---|---|---|
| Car | Moderate – Fast | Medium | Precise timing, short dashes. |
| Truck | Slow – Moderate | High (large size) | Avoid direct positioning in its path. |
| Motorcycle | Fast | Medium | Anticipate quick movements. |
| Bus | Slow | Very High (size and long stopping distance) | Wait for a large, clear gap. |
Beyond understanding individual vehicle behavior, observing the overall ārhythmā of the traffic flow is important. Are there periods of relative calm followed by surges in activity? Identifying these cycles can inform your strategy, prompting you to take risks during lulls and exercise greater caution during peaks. This is the nuance that separates casual players from true high-score contenders.

Strategies for Maximizing Score and Distance
Simply surviving isn't enough; the goal is to maximize your score and achieve the longest possible distance. Several strategies can help you climb the leaderboard. One approach is to prioritize small, incremental advances. Rather than attempting risky leaps across multiple lanes, focus on safely moving forward one or two steps at a time. This minimizes the chance of a collision and allows you to consistently accumulate distance. Another tactic is to exploit the "wake" of faster vehicles. By following closely behind a speeding car, you can sometimes create a temporary safe zone, allowing you to advance more quickly.
Risk vs Reward Assessment
However, these strategies arenāt without their risks. Following too closely behind a vehicle can leave you vulnerable if it suddenly slows down or changes lanes. Therefore, itās crucial to constantly assess the risk-reward ratio of each move. Is the potential gain in distance worth the increased chance of a collision? Experienced players learn to weigh these factors instinctively, making informed decisions based on the current traffic conditions. Furthermore, some games offer power-ups or special abilities ā such as temporary invincibility or speed boosts ā that can significantly enhance your performance. Learning to utilize these power-ups strategically is essential for maximizing your score. The effective use of a carefully considered plan will take you much farther on the chicken road.
